Transaction 63de683dc5073f22423c862264d3359df2310f776310918624407d5efd9c1dc7
1 Input
1 Output
-
63de683dc5073f22423c862264d3359df2310f776310918624407d5efd9c1dc7:0
- value
- 550694
- script pubkey
- OP_0 OP_PUSHBYTES_20 e21561665768db1fa6c0673a447b99c1d620d4a9
- address
- bc1qug2kzejhdrd3lfkqvuayg7uec8tzp49fga0qxx